Default Latin food market

I am trying to find out if there are any Latin food markets in the Newport News area. I am looking for a place that sells typical Central American or Mexican style goods (bodega). Does anyone know of a place like this? Thanks!

There's a small Mexican store on HWY 60/Warwick blvd between Denbigh and Fort Eustis called "La Mexicana". I go there with my wife regularly for the pan dulce and other latin sweets they sell. You can call them to ask about bodega - the phone # is 877-0666.

There's a larger international food market on Warwick between Denbigh and Oyster Point, but I'm not sure how much Latin food they have (mostly Asian items).

Just FYI for any European interest - the "Euro Food" store on HWY 17 next to County Grill has mostly Eastern European and Russian foods there, including caviar.
